HDMI (High-Definition Multimedia Interface) slots have become ubiquitous in modern electronic devices, providing a seamless and reliable connection for high-quality audio and video transmission. This versatile interface has revolutionized home entertainment, gaming, and professional content creation, enabling users to enjoy immersive multimedia experiences on various platforms.
Connectivity: HDMI slots facilitate seamless connections between devices such as Blu-ray players, game consoles, cable boxes, and laptops to TVs, monitors, and projectors. This eliminates the need for multiple cables for audio and video transmission.
High-Definition Quality: HDMI supports various video resolutions, up to 4K at 60Hz, and HDR (High Dynamic Range) for enhanced color depth and contrast. This ensures stunning visuals with sharp images, vibrant colors, and intricate details.
Audio Performance: HDMI slots not only transmit video signals but also deliver multi-channel audio, including lossless formats such as Dolby TrueHD and DTS-HD Master Audio. This means that you can enjoy immersive surround sound that complements the visual experience.
Compatibility: HDMI slots are compliant with various industry standards, ensuring compatibility with a wide range of devices. This interoperability makes it easy to connect and integrate devices from different manufacturers.
HDMI specifications have evolved over the years, bringing new features and improved performance.
Specification | Resolution | Features |
---|---|---|
HDMI 1.3 | 1080p60 | Deep Color, Lip Sync Control |
HDMI 1.4 | 4K30 | Ethernet, Audio Return Channel, 3D Support |
HDMI 2.0 | 4K60 | HDR, 18Gbps Bandwidth |
HDMI 2.1 | 4K120, 8K60 | Dynamic HDR, Enhanced Audio Return Channel |
